Summary
Scientists are uncovering why highly pathogenic avian influenza H5N1 went undetected for weeks at a Texas dairy farm in the United States in 2024. The key finding is that the virus concentrated in the mammary glands and milk rather than the respiratory tract, slipping through a blind spot in the existing surveillance system. H5N1 has traditionally been recognized as a disease that rapidly kills poultry such as chickens and ducks, and disease-control and surveillance protocols were designed around respiratory symptoms and mass die-offs. In dairy cattle, however, this typical pattern did not appear.
Instead of clear respiratory symptoms, the cows showed non-specific signs such as reduced milk output and changes in milk consistency, while the virus was detected at high concentrations in mammary tissue and milk. While farms and veterinary authorities focused on respiratory samples, the actual source of infection lay along a different route. As a result, an accurate diagnosis was delayed for a considerable period after the initial spread, and the possibility of transmission via the milking process and equipment drew attention only belatedly.
The Structural Background
The crux of the matter is the distribution of viral receptors. Influenza viruses bind to specific cell-surface receptors to gain entry, and analysis suggests that the mammary tissue of dairy cattle provided the environment this virus favors. In other words, H5N1 may be able to adaptively establish itself in specific mammalian organs, suggesting that the cross-species barrier may be lower than previously assumed. This does not directly imply a risk of human infection, but it does create policy pressure to redesign which subjects are monitored and which body sites are sampled.
